In the specialized world of commercial and industrial packaging, terminology can often become a source of confusion, leading businesses to question whether they are evaluating the same equipment under different names. This is particularly true in the food service and food production sectors, where specific brand names have, over time, become synonymous with the generic products they represent. The terms “Glad Wrap” and “Cling Film” are a prime example of this phenomenon. Professionals looking to invest in new food wrapping equipment frequently encounter both terms, prompting a critical question about their interchangeability and the nature of the machinery designed to handle these materials.

Yes, functionally, a “Glad Wrap machine” is the same as a “Cling Film machine.” “Glad Wrap” is a specific brand name that has become a generic trademark, much like “Kleenex” for tissues or “Band-Aid” for adhesive bandages. “Cling Film” is the correct generic term for the thin, plastic film used for food preservation. Therefore, any machine designed to apply Glad Wrap is, by definition, a Cling Film Wrapping Machine.

Understanding the Terminology: Brand Name vs. Generic Term

The term “Glad Wrap” is a brand name that has entered the common lexicon as a substitute for “cling film,” the generic name for the product itself. This linguistic phenomenon, known as a generic trademark or proprietary eponym, occurs when a brand name becomes so dominant in a market that it is used by the public to refer to an entire class of products, regardless of the manufacturer. This is a common occurrence in consumer goods and extends into the industrial machinery that handles them. When a business searches for a “Glad Wrap machine,” they are searching for a machine that applies cling film, regardless of whether that machine is made by the original brand’s parent company or another manufacturer of industrial food wrapping equipment.

What Exactly is a Cling Film Wrapping Machine?

A Cling Film Wrapping Machine is a piece of mechanical or automated equipment designed to efficiently and hygienically apply a thin, plastic film—cling film—over a product, typically for food preservation, presentation, and contamination prevention. These machines are engineered to perform this task at a speed and consistency that is impossible to achieve manually, making them an indispensable asset in any commercial food operation. From a small deli to a large-scale food processing plant, the cling film wrapping machine for food is a cornerstone of modern food handling, directly impacting product quality, shelf life, and operational efficiency.

At its core, this type of food wrapping equipment is designed to solve several key challenges. First and foremost is hygiene. The machine creates a protective barrier that shields food from airborne contaminants like dust, bacteria, and other pathogens, which is critical for complying with food safety regulations. Second, it preserves freshness. The film significantly reduces the rate of dehydration and limits exposure to oxygen, which can cause spoilage, discoloration, and loss of flavor. This extends the product’s shelf life, directly reducing food waste and increasing profitability. Third, it enhances presentation. A neatly wrapped product looks more professional and appealing to consumers, which can drive sales in a retail environment.

The sophistication of these machines can vary dramatically. At the most basic level, a simple manual device might assist an operator in cutting and dispensing the film. At the other end of the spectrum are highly complex, fully integrated automatic cling film wrapping machines that can wrap hundreds or even thousands of products per hour as part of a continuous production line. Regardless of their level of automation, all these machines share the same fundamental purpose: to provide a fast, reliable, and sanitary method for sealing food items with cling film.

The Core Functionality of a Cling Film Wrapping Machine for Food

The core functionality of a cling film wrapping machine for food revolves around a sequence of automated or semi-automated steps: dispensing a sheet of film, draping it over the product, and then cutting and sealing it to create a secure, often airtight, enclosure. This process is meticulously engineered to maximize speed and consistency while ensuring the integrity of the seal and the hygiene of the product. Understanding this process is key to appreciating the value these machines bring to a commercial operation.

The process typically begins with the product—such as a tray of meat, a prepared meal, or a plate of cheese—being placed on the machine’s working surface, which could be a flat platform, a conveyor belt, or a rotating turntable, depending on the machine’s design. The machine then automatically advances a roll of cling film. A cutting mechanism, often a heated wire or a sharp blade, severs a sheet of the film at a pre-determined length. This sheet is then precisely draped over the product. The automation in this step ensures that the amount of film used is consistent and optimized, minimizing waste compared to manual cutting.

The final and most critical step is sealing. For many applications, a heated sealing plate or bar is lowered onto the film around the edges of the product tray. The heat melts the film layers together, fusing them to create a strong, hermetic seal. This seal is what locks in freshness and provides the protective barrier. In more advanced automatic cling film wrapping machines, this entire cycle—from product placement to sealed product discharge—occurs in a matter of seconds. The precision of the temperature, pressure, and dwell time of the sealing element is crucial for creating a perfect seal every time, a level of control that is simply unattainable through manual methods.

Types of Food Wrapping Equipment: Manual vs. Automatic

Food wrapping equipment for cling film is broadly categorized into two primary types: manual and fully automatic, representing two distinct ends of the spectrum in terms of operator involvement, throughput, and investment cost. The choice between these two fundamental types is a critical decision that hinges on a business’s scale, production goals, and financial capacity. This binary choice forces a clear strategic direction: either prioritize low initial cost and flexibility with a manual system, or prioritize maximum speed, efficiency, and consistency with an automatic system.

  • Manual Cling Film Wrappers: These machines are the most basic and entry-level option, designed for operations where volume is low to moderate and labor is readily available. They typically feature a foot pedal or a simple button that the operator presses to initiate the cutting and sealing cycle. The operator is responsible for manually placing each product on the platform, positioning it correctly, and removing it once the cycle is complete. These machines are ideal for small businesses like independent delis, butcher shops, cafes, and small catering services. They offer a significant improvement in speed and consistency over hand-wrapping while requiring a minimal initial investment, making them an accessible first step into mechanized wrapping.

  • Fully Automatic Cling Film Wrapping Machines: At the opposite end of the spectrum are fully automatic systems, the pinnacle of food wrapping equipment technology. These are engineered for high-volume industrial use and are designed to operate as a fully integrated component of a production line. Products are automatically conveyed, positioned, wrapped, sealed, and discharged without any human intervention, other than initial setup and supervision. Automatic cling film wrapping machines can operate at incredible speeds, capable of wrapping hundreds or even thousands of items per hour. They are equipped with advanced features like PLC controls, touch-screen interfaces, and sensors that can automatically adjust to different product sizes. The high initial investment is justified by massive labor savings, unparalleled consistency, and the ability to meet the demanding throughput of large-scale food manufacturers and central packaging facilities.

Feature Type Manual Wrapper Automatic Wrapper
Operator Involvement High (placing, initiating, removing) Low (supervision only)
Throughput Low to Medium Very High
Initial Investment Low Very High
Ideal For Small delis, cafes, caterers Large food manufacturers
Labor Cost High Low
Consistency Good Excellent

Key Benefits of Investing in Automatic Cling Film Wrapping Machines

Investing in automatic cling film wrapping machines offers transformative benefits, including drastically increased production speed, significant long-term labor savings, enhanced product consistency and hygiene, and a substantial reduction in material waste. For any business whose volume has outgrown manual methods, the move to full automation represents a strategic leap forward that can redefine operational efficiency and profitability. The advantages extend far beyond simply wrapping products faster.

One of the most compelling benefits is the dramatic increase in throughput. A single automatic cling film wrapping machine can perform the work of several manual wrappers, operating continuously without fatigue. This allows a business to scale up its production to meet growing demand without needing to hire and train additional staff. This directly translates to lower labor costs per unit, a critical metric in the competitive food industry. Furthermore, the consistency of an automated process is unmatched. Every product is wrapped with the same amount of film, the same seal quality, and the same precision, creating a uniform and professional appearance that enhances brand image.

Hygiene and food safety are also significantly improved. By minimizing human contact with the product and the wrapping material, automated systems reduce the risk of cross-contamination. The machines are built from food-grade materials like stainless steel and are designed for easy cleaning and sanitization, helping businesses comply with stringent health and safety regulations like HACCP. Finally, these machines are highly efficient in their use of film. Advanced sensors and programming ensure that only the necessary amount of film is used for each product, cutting down on waste and reducing the cost of consumables. When combined, these benefits provide a powerful return on investment, making a Cling Film Wrapping Machine a cornerstone of a modern, efficient, and profitable food operation.

Essential Features to Look for in a Modern Cling Film Wrapping Machine

When selecting a modern Cling Film Wrapping Machine, essential features to look for include food-grade construction, adjustability for various product sizes, user-friendly controls, reliable sealing technology, and easy-to-clean designs. These features determine the machine’s versatility, longevity, safety, and overall return on investment. A thorough evaluation based on these criteria will ensure that the chosen food wrapping equipment will meet the specific needs of your operation both now and in the future.

  • Food-Grade Construction: The machine should be constructed primarily from high-quality stainless steel (e.g., AISI 304). This material is non-porous, resistant to corrosion from cleaning chemicals, and does not support bacterial growth, making it essential for any cling film wrapping machine for food. All components that come into contact with the film or the product should be certified as food-safe.

  • Adjustability and Versatility: Your business may package a variety of products in different sized trays, containers, or plates. The machine you choose must be easily adjustable to accommodate these variations. Look for features like adjustable film dispensers, variable sealing plate sizes, and programmable settings that can be saved for different products. This versatility ensures the machine can grow and adapt with your business.

  • User-Friendly Controls: A modern machine should be intuitive to operate. Look for a PLC (Programmable Logic Controller) system with a touch-screen interface. This allows operators to easily change settings, monitor the machine’s performance, and diagnose issues without extensive technical training. Clear, simple controls reduce the risk of operator error and minimize downtime.

  • Reliable Sealing Technology: The quality of the seal is paramount. The machine should feature a precise and consistent sealing system. A constant heat sealing bar with adjustable temperature and time controls is a standard and effective feature. Some advanced machines may offer impulse sealing or other technologies for specific film types. The goal is a strong, reliable seal every single time.

  • Ease of Cleaning and Maintenance: Sanitation is non-negotiable. The machine should be designed with hygiene in mind. Look for a design with minimal crevices, rounded corners, and easily removable components. This allows for quick and thorough cleaning, reducing the risk of contamination and ensuring the machine can be returned to service quickly. Easy access to mechanical parts also simplifies routine maintenance, further reducing downtime.

Applications Across Various Industries

While primarily associated with food service, the applications for a Cling Film Wrapping Machine span across numerous industries, including fresh produce processing, meat and seafood packaging, bakery and confectionery, ready-meal production, and even non-food sectors like cosmetics or pharmaceuticals for product protection. The fundamental need to preserve, protect, and present a product is universal, and the technology provided by these machines is adaptable to a wide range of contexts.

In the fresh produce and deli sector, a Cling Film Wrapping Machine is used to wrap trays of cut fruits, salads, cheese, and cold cuts. The airtight seal maintains moisture and crispness while preventing oxidation. In meat and seafood processing, these machines are critical for extending the shelf life of fresh products, protecting them from bacteria and preserving their color. For the bakery and confectionery industry, the machines wrap cakes, pastries, and chocolates, protecting them from drying out and from handling damage. The clear film also showcases the product, enticing customers.

The ready-meal and catering industry relies heavily on automatic cling film wrapping machines to efficiently package large volumes of prepared meals for retail or distribution. The speed and hygiene of these machines are essential for meeting the demands of this fast-growing market. Beyond food, the technology can be adapted for other uses. For example, in the cosmetics industry, a similar machine might be used to wrap gift sets or to protect the contents of a box. In some industrial applications, it could be used to provide a temporary protective cover for sensitive components during assembly or storage. This versatility underscores the value of the Cling Film Wrapping Machine as a multi-purpose packaging solution.
